    EMG110 Q3

    I. Choose the correct answer (write in CAPITAL LETTER)1. It is the assignment of additional responsibilities to a subordinate.

    a. Decentralization b. Delegation c. Departmentation d. Integration

    2. A leader with this type of power influences subordinates because he or she controls valued rewards.a. legitimate b. referent c. reward d. coercive

    3. A leader with this type of power has personal characteristics that appeal to others especially the subordinates.

    a. legitimate b. referent c. reward d. coercive4. A leader with this type of power has the right, or the authority, to tell subordinates what to do; subordinates

    are obliged to comply with legitimate orders.

    a. legitimate b. referent c. reward d. coercive5. A leader with this type of power has control over punishments.

    a. legitimate b. expertness c. reward d. coercive

    6. A leader with this type of power has certain expertise or knowledge; subordinates comply because they

    believe in, can learn from or otherwise gain from that expertise.a. legitimate b. expertness c. reward d. coercive

    7. The process of designing jobs so that jobholders have only a small number of narrow activities to perform.

    a. Job Rotation b. Job Enlargement c. Job Simplification d. Job Enrichment

    8. The practice of periodically shifting workers through a set of jobs in a planned sequencea. Job Rotation b. Job Enlargement c. Job Simplification d. Job Enrichment

    9. The allocation of a wider variety of similar tasks to a job in order to make it more challenging

    a. Job Rotation b. Job Enlargement c. job Simplification d. Job Enrichment10. The process of upgrading the job-task mix in order to increase significantly the potentials for growth,

    achievement, responsibility, and recognition.

    a. Job Rotation b. Job Enlargement c. job Simplification d. Job Enrichment11. It results from the grouping of work by functions, products, customers, and geography, the desire to obtain

    organization units of manageable size, and to utilize managerial ability.

    a. Decentralization b. Delegation c. Departmentation d. Integration

    12. The following are the elements of delegation except:

    a. Responsibility b. Availability c. Authority d. Accountability13. The process of encouraging, inducing, or influencing applicants to apply for a certain vacant position.

    a. Staffing b. Recruitment c. Selection d. Training14. The process of getting the most qualified applicant from among different job seekers.

    a. Staffing b. Recruitment c. Selection d. Training

    15. It is the systematic development of the attitude/knowledge/behavior patterns for the adequate performance

    of a given job or task.a. Staffing b. Recruitment c. Selection d. Training

    16. Refers to the shifting of an employee from one position to another without increasing his duties,

    responsibilities, or pay.

    a. Separation b. Promotion c. Transfer d. Outplacement

    17. Refers to the shifting of an employee to a new position to which both his status and responsibilities areincreased.

    a. Separation b. Promotion c. Transfer d. Outplacement18. The process of helping people who have been dismissed from the company to regain employment

    elsewhere.

    a. Separation b. Promotion c. Transfer d. Outplacement19. A type of separation, temporary and involuntary, usually traceable to a negative business condition

    a. Lay-off b. Discharge c. Resignation d. Retirement

    20. A permanent separation of an employee, at the will of an employer, if a person is not competent in his job,guilty of breaking rules like delinquency and insubordination, and other violations.

    a. Lay-off b. Discharge c. Resignation d. Retirement
